Subject: Date-format localization cut-over complete

Hi support team,

The Lanternbook cut-over finished this morning. All customer-facing dates now render per the user's locale instead of the old fixed format. Expect a few tickets from users surprised by the change; point them to the preferences page. For reference, the service now runs with these values.

deployment values, yadug-bawif:
[framir]
team = pelox
access_code = ac_a38ab2
owner = tamion.julael
host = framir.tolvaqlabs.test
port = 11211
peer = tammir.zemvargrid.local
salt = 2215ef03
pin = 1541

# Cron drift investigation — Plover scheduler plugins.
# Jobs on the Marrow cluster drift up to 40s under load; set
# CRON_DRIFT_TRACE=1 to emit timing spans your plugin can consume.
# Do not batch compensating runs yourself; the host handles it.
# The trace collector requires an API secret, set on the next line.

sealed setting: ARCHIVE_KEY3=8d0

The Pedalmere rebalancing tool assigns van routes every 20 minutes based on dock occupancy forecasts. If routes stop updating, check the forecast job first — a stale forecast halts assignment rather than dispatching vans on bad data. A manual override exists but requires dispatcher sign-off; contractors should not trigger it unsupervised. Routine restarts are safe and preserve in-flight routes. The full operating procedure and override checklist are on the internal page below.

wiki page, hahif-hahif: https://argocd.kelvisys.corp/browse/board/settings/pages/1442e0b1065d83f1